上市银行2025年年报:业绩增速有望稳中向好,资产质量持续优化
ZHONGTAI SECURITIES· 2026-02-08 07:25
Investment Rating - The industry investment rating is maintained at "Overweight" [2] Core Insights - The report indicates that the performance of listed banks is expected to improve steadily, with asset quality continuing to optimize. Eight out of eleven banks reported a rebound in revenue growth, and eight also saw profit growth recover. Six banks experienced a decrease in non-performing loan (NPL) ratios, while seven banks reported an increase in provisions [5][10][11] - The forecast for 2025 suggests that net interest income and net fee income for listed banks will continue to recover, with overall revenue growth expected to remain stable. Non-interest income may face some pressure, but the impact is limited [5][30] - The report highlights that the performance of joint-stock banks is recovering, while city commercial banks maintain high growth rates. The overall asset quality is improving, with a notable decrease in NPL ratios for several banks [6][8][11] Summary by Sections 1. Performance Overview of 11 Banks - Eight banks reported a rebound in revenue growth, and eight also saw profit growth recover. Six banks experienced a decrease in NPL ratios, while seven banks reported an increase in provisions. The performance of joint-stock banks is recovering, and city commercial banks maintain high growth [5][10][11] 2. Scale Forecast for 2025 - The total social financing is expected to grow by 8.3% year-on-year, with credit balance growth remaining stable at 6.4%. Major provinces like Sichuan, Jiangsu, Shandong, Zhejiang, and Shanghai are expected to maintain credit growth above 8% [12][30] 3. Net Interest Margin Forecast for 2025 - The net interest margin for the fourth quarter of 2025 is expected to stabilize, with a slight decrease of 0.1 basis points. The pressure on asset repricing is expected to diminish, supporting the net interest margin [13][30] 4. Asset Quality Forecast for 2025 - The trend of improving asset quality is expected to continue, with public sector loans improving and retail exposure remaining stable. The report predicts that retail NPL ratios will see slight increases, but overall asset quality is expected to remain robust [16][30] 5. Revenue and Profit Estimates for 2025 - The report estimates that net interest income will decline by 0.1% year-on-year, with city commercial banks expected to show a growth rate of 10.8%. The overall profit growth for the industry is expected to remain stable, with a projected net profit growth of around 1.6% for the fourth quarter of 2025 [25][31]
银行24A、25Q1业绩综述:正负之间的约束与希望
CMS· 2025-05-05 05:33
Investment Rating - The report maintains a recommendation for the banking sector [2] Core Insights - The banking sector's performance in Q1 2025 shows a decline in revenue, PPOP, and net profit growth rates, with respective year-on-year changes of -1.72%, -2.15%, and -1.20% [1][15] - The decline in profit growth reflects constraints on the banking industry's profit flexibility and willingness to release [12][14] - The adjustment in the bond market has impacted revenue, particularly affecting non-interest income, which saw a significant drop in growth [12][13] - The report suggests that the negative growth in Q1 does not necessarily indicate a negative trend for the entire year, as historical data shows potential for recovery [14] Summary by Sections 1. Performance Overview - The overall performance of listed banks in 2024 showed marginal improvement, but Q1 2025 experienced a setback with net profit growth turning negative [15] - In 2024, listed banks achieved total revenue of 5.65 trillion yuan and net profit of 2.14 trillion yuan, with respective growth rates of 0.08%, -0.70%, and 2.35% [15][21] 2. Net Interest Income - Net interest income growth is showing signs of recovery, with improvements in loan stability and deposit recovery [15] 3. Non-Interest Income - Non-interest income has turned negative, significantly impacting overall performance [12][15] 4. Asset Quality - The asset quality remains stable, but attention is needed on retail and small micro-enterprise loans [15] 5. Costs and Taxes - The report discusses the cost-to-income ratio and tax implications for the banking sector [15] 6. Capital and Dividends - The capital adequacy ratio has decreased in Q1, but the report emphasizes that a negative growth in Q1 does not imply a negative annual performance [14][15] 7. Investment Recommendations - The report advocates for a balanced investment strategy focusing on long-term growth and cash flow perspectives across different bank segments [6][15]
江苏银行(600919):净利息收入高增
CMS· 2025-04-28 14:10
Investment Rating - The report maintains a strong buy recommendation for Jiangsu Bank (600919.SH) [4] Core Views - Jiangsu Bank's net interest income saw a significant increase of 22% year-on-year in Q1 2025, reaching 16.6 billion yuan, driven by rapid asset growth and optimized liability costs [2][3] - The bank's asset quality remains robust, with a non-performing loan ratio of 0.86% and a provision coverage ratio of 343.51% as of Q1 2025 [2][3] - The bank's non-interest income experienced a decline of 32.72% year-on-year, primarily due to a significant drop in fair value changes, although investment income increased by 30.1% [3] Summary by Sections Performance - In Q1 2025, Jiangsu Bank reported a revenue growth of 6.21%, PPOP growth of 7.88%, and a net profit growth of 8.16% compared to the previous year [1][11] - The bank's total assets reached 4.46 trillion yuan, with total deposits of 2.46 trillion yuan [11] Non-Interest Income - The bank's net fee and commission income grew by 21.77% year-on-year in Q1 2025, benefiting from a recovery in the capital market and macroeconomic conditions [2][3][29] Interest Margin and Asset Quality - The bank's interest-earning assets grew by 27.82% year-on-year, with loans increasing by 18.83% [2] - The net interest margin showed a slight decline but was supported by effective cost management on liabilities [2][3] Capital and Shareholder Information - Jiangsu Bank's return on equity (ROE) was reported at 16.50% for Q1 2025, with a target price of 10.13 yuan per share [4][27] - The bank's major shareholder is Jiangsu International Trust Co., holding a 6.98% stake [4]
